Good Vibes 2011 & the best Good Vibes EVER!

So it was okay weather in the morning but as I watched in amazement at Erykah Badu's terrific set, the rain begun falling! And falling and falling all day. This however beat the heat in the past when I went to this interesting festival that is changing shape every year.

So first up on my day of Good Vibes was the divine Erykah Badu, she was simply amazing. The crowd loved her and the beats and rhymes were amazing. She played my favourite "Love of My Life" (less Common) and also the dreamy "Window Seat".

Then it was onto the very wet but bloody fun main stage with the Ting Tings. They played all their big hits from their debut opening with "Great DJ" and spinning "Fruit Machine", "Shut Up & Let Me Go" and closing with the extremely fun "That's not my Name". The new hit "Hands" was great too, overall they did the best possible with a small back catalogue and played to some die hard fans in the moist weather.

Then it was onto the MOST AMAZING Kelis! Great! The new album went off live (shame the sales are woeful) and she threw in some amazing old tracks including a mash up of Holiday and "Milkshake". Her performance, her performance was simply delightful! I loved every minute of her performance and also think this woman is one of the most under valued solo female performers of all time, thank you Good Vibes for providing this truly awesome performer!

Then was a touch of Damian Marley and Nas followed by some Ludacris. Overall Erykah and Kelis, what a day, it was awesome, it was wet, it was loose. Good Vibes you put on a winner this year despite no shows from Janelle Monae and Cee-Lo Green.

5 stars for the Good Vibes in 2011
